Typical Car Locking Issues and How a Local Locksmith Can Help
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
Issue: Losing car keys can be a stressful and inconvenient experience. It can leave you stranded and vulnerable to theft.Option: A local locksmith can create a brand-new set of keys based upon your car's make, model, and year. They can likewise program brand-new electronic keys if your car utilizes a transponder or chip key.
Locked Out of Your Car
Issue: Accidentally locking your type in the car can be an aggravating circumstance, particularly if you require to get somewhere rapidly.Option: A locksmith can quickly and efficiently unlock your car without triggering damage to the vehicle. They use specialized tools and strategies to get entry securely.
Jammed Ignition
Issue: A jammed ignition can avoid your car from starting, leaving you stranded.Option: A locksmith can detect the issue and either repair or replace the ignition lock cylinder. They can also provide ideas to avoid future jams.
Broken Car Locks
Issue: Damaged car locks can compromise the security of your vehicle and make it challenging to lock or open the doors.Solution: A locksmith can replace broken locks and rekey your car to make sure that all locks are integrated and protected.
Keyless Entry System Malfunctions
Issue: Modern cars and trucks typically feature keyless entry systems, which can malfunction due to battery issues or signal interference.Option: A locksmith can fix and repair keyless entry systems, guaranteeing they operate properly.Benefits of Using a Local Locksmith for Car Services

Q1: How much does it cost to get a new car key made by a locksmith?
A1: The expense can differ depending on the kind of key and the complexity of the car's locking system. Usually, a simple key duplication can cost between ₤ 20 and ₤ 50, while a transponder key programming can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200.
Q2: Can a locksmith unlock my car without harming it?
A2: Yes, expert locksmith professionals are trained to utilize non-destructive approaches to unlock cars. They use specialized tools to acquire entry without triggering any damage to the vehicle.
Q3: Do I require to stay with my car while the locksmith works?
A3: It is generally recommended to stick with your car while the locksmith works, particularly if the problem includes keys or locks. This guarantees that you exist to authorize the work and confirm that everything is done properly.
Q4: How long does it take for a locksmith to get here?
A4: The response time can differ, however lots of local locksmiths offer 30-minute to 1-hour action times. If you need instant support, look for a locksmith who supplies emergency services.
Q5: Can a locksmith replace my car's ignition key?
A5: Yes, a locksmith can replace your car's ignition key. They can also rekey your ignition lock cylinder to make sure that it matches the brand-new key.
Q6: Are locksmith professionals legally permitted to deal with car locks?
A6: Yes, licensed locksmiths are lawfully allowed to work on car locks. They must abide by strict regulations and standards to guarantee the safety and security of your vehicle.
Q7: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
A7: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not attempt to eliminate it yourself. Contact a professional locksmith who has the tools and competence to extract the broken key without harming the lock.
